Examine Door Seals
Three simple actions can assist you ensure your home appliance's door seals remain in excellent condition. Check the seals consistently for any splits, rips, or indications of wear. These problems can cause air leakages, affecting efficiency. Second, tidy the seals making use of warm, soapy water to remove any kind of debris or grime. A clean seal guarantees a limited fit and far better efficiency. Lastly, carry out a basic test by shutting the door on a piece of paper. If you can easily draw it out without resistance, the seal may need changing. By adhering to these steps, you'll preserve your appliance's efficiency and durability, conserving you money on energy expenses and fixings in the long run.
Monitor Temperature Level Setups
On a regular basis checking your appliance's temperature level settings is necessary for best performance and effectiveness. Whether you're managing a fridge, fridge freezer, or stove, keeping an eye on these settings can prevent several concerns. For fridges, objective for temperatures between 35 ° F and 38 ° F; for freezers, remain 0 ° F. If the temperatures are expensive or low, your home appliance might work harder, losing energy and reducing its life expectancy. Utilize a thermometer to examine these settings on a regular basis, specifically after major adjustments, like relocating your appliance or changing the thermostat. If you discover fluctuations, change the settings as necessary and speak with the individual manual for support. By remaining positive regarding temperature level tracking, you'll assure your appliances run efficiently and last much longer.
Repairing Cooling Concerns
When your fridge isn't cooling down correctly, it can bring about ruined food and threw away money, so addressing the problem immediately is crucial. Begin by checking the temperature level settings to confirm they're at the recommended degrees, usually around 37 ° F for the fridge and 0 ° F for the fridge freezer. If the setups are correct, inspect the door seals for any type of gaps or damage; a damaged seal can enable warm air to enter.
Next, examine the vents inside the fridge and freezer. Confirm they're not obstructed by food items, as this can interrupt air movement. Listen for the compressor; if it's not running or making uncommon sounds, it may require focus. Ultimately, inspect the condenser coils, generally situated at the back or base of the unit. Dirt and debris can gather, triggering cooling concerns. Clean them with a vacuum or brush to maximize efficiency. If problems persist, it may be time to call a specialist.

Recognize Leakage Sources
Exactly how can you effectively recognize the sources of water leakage and ice build-up in your home appliances? Start by evaluating the seals and gaskets on your fridge and fridge freezer doors. A used or broken seal can allow cozy air to go into, creating condensation and ice. Next off, examine the drain frying pan and drain system for clogs or blockages; a backed-up drainpipe can bring about water pooling. Search for any loosened links in the water line, which can create leakages. Additionally, examine the defrost drain for ice build-up, which could disrupt correct water drainage. By systematically inspecting these areas, you'll identify the source of the problem, enabling you to take the needed actions to repair it and extend your device's lifespan.

Just how Typically Should I Tidy the Refrigerator Coils?
You must cleanse your refrigerator coils every six months. This helps keep effectiveness and stops getting too hot. If you discover too much dirt or pet hair, tidy them more frequently to assure your fridge runs smoothly.

What Temperature Should My Fridge Be Set To?
You ought to set your fridge to 37 ° F(3 ° C) for excellent food preservation. This temperature level maintains your food fresh while protecting against perishing, ensuring your grocery stores last longer and reducing waste. It's an easy modification you can make!
Does a Refrigerator Required to Be Leveled?
Yes, your refrigerator requires to be leveled. If it's uneven, it can affect cooling down performance and create excess noise. Inspect the progressing legs and adjust them to ensure proper equilibrium for excellent efficiency.
Just How Can I Decrease Refrigerator Power Consumption?
To lower your fridge's energy intake, maintain it tidy and well-ventilated, examine door seals for leaks, set the temperature between 35-38 ° F, and prevent straining it. These actions can substantially lower your power costs.
